Best time to go to Dreghorn

The best time to visit Dreghorn is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January38.8°F (3.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ly Low
February39.4°F (4.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ly Low
March41.4°F (5.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
April45.1°F (7.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
May50.0°F (10.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
June55.4°F (13.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ly High
July57.4°F (14.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
August56.8°F (13.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
September54.0°F (12.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
October49.1°F (9.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
November43.5°F (6.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
December40.1°F (4.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low

What's the weather like in Dreghorn?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 13°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 4°C. Average annual precipitation for Dreghorn is 1503 mm.
